## Approvals — SquatSentry Scanner

Changes to SquatSentry's detection rules require one approval before merge. Routine dependency bumps may self-merge after CI passes. New heuristics or allowlist edits always need review, since false positives block publishes across Hallowmere teams. Emergency overrides must be logged in the incident channel. The current approver of record is listed below.

approver of faduf-bagug = Framir Sorwyn

Onboarding: the tax-rate lookup cache (codename Ledgerline). When an order quotes a tax rate, the service checks an in-memory cache first, then falls back to the regional rate table. Cache entries expire after 24 hours, so a newly published rate can take up to a day to appear — this is the most common source of "wrong tax" tickets. Before escalating, check the entry's fetched-at timestamp in the admin view. A manual cache-flush procedure, with guardrails, is documented on the internal page below.

operations page: https://jenkins.zemvarcloud.local/job/merge_requests/repo/build/73930b4b30f0a8ed

## Further reading

The Wavelet panel renders audio waveform previews for uploaded clips. Previews are generated asynchronously by the chirprender worker; a grey bar means the job is still queued, not a failed upload. Supported formats, retry behavior, and common customer-facing errors are covered in the support playbook. If a preview stays grey past ten minutes, escalate per the playbook rather than re-uploading on the customer's behalf. The playbook, along with worker status dashboards and escalation contacts, lives on the internal page.

wiki page, tahaf-tajog: https://jira.ordindyn.corp/pipeline

Q: Why does the address autocomplete widget sometimes show stale suggestions?
A: The Quickfill widget caches results locally for 24 hours, so freshly added addresses can lag. You can force a refresh from the widget settings panel. If suggestions are still wrong after that, send the team a quick note.

escalation mailbox, bafog-fafog: ulador@paliqlabs.internal